About

Shanghai Golden Bridge InfoTech Co.,Ltd provides smart space information solutions and services in China. The company offers smart scene solutions, smart building solutions and big data solutions. It also involved in the procurement and sale of conference systems, intelligent court systems, emergency command systems, and other products; technical research and development of computer hardware and … Read more

Shanghai Golden Bridge (603918)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of September 2025: CN¥997.72 Million CNY

Based on the latest financial reports, Shanghai Golden Bridge (603918) has net assets worth CN¥997.72 Million CNY as of September 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(CN¥1.44 Billion) and total liabilities (CN¥445.81 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

Equity Growth Attribution

This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Shanghai Golden Bridge's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.

Equity Growth Insights

  • From 2023 to 2024, total equity changed from 1,120,497,486 to 1,067,073,661, a change of -53,423,825 (-4.8%).
  • Net loss of 60,834,976 reduced equity.
  • Dividend payments of 14,774,264 reduced retained earnings.
  • Share repurchases of 2,543,150 reduced equity.
  • Other comprehensive income increased equity by 108,486.
  • Other factors increased equity by 24,620,079.
